400 bad request

Nếu bạn là một người thường xuyên sử dụng mạng Internet thì chắc hẳn bạn đã từng gặp phải lỗi báo 400 Bad Request khiến bạn không thể truy cập vào website. Đừng quá lo lắng, hãy cùng nhau tìm hiểu về lỗi 400 Bad Request, nguyên nhân và cách khắc phục ở bài viết dưới đây nhé!

Lỗi 400 Bad Request là gì? Nguyên nhân, cách khắc phục
Lỗi 400 Bad Request là gì? Nguyên nhân, cách khắc phục

Lỗi 400 Bad Request là gì?

Khái niệm

Lỗi 400 Bad Request có nghĩa là “yêu cầu không hợp lệ“. Lỗi trạng thái này cho biết khi bạn thực hiện thao thác một hành động hoặc gửi yêu cầu đến website thì máy chủ không thể xử lý yêu cầu do cú pháp thực hiện không đúng định dạng. Ví dụ như cú pháp yêu cầu không đúng định dạng, kích thước quá lớn, khung thông báo yêu cầu không hợp lệ hoặc định tuyến yêu cầu lừa đảo.

Trong một số trường hợp hi hữu thì lỗi này có thể do sự cố server gây ra. Tuy nhiên, phần lớn trong mọi trường hợp thì lỗi này xuất phát từ phía người sử dụng, khiến bạn không thể truy cập vào website.

400 Bad Request
400 Bad Request

Các thông báo của lỗi 400 Bad Request

  • 400 Bad Request.
  • 400 – Bad request. The request could not be understood by the server due to malformed syntax. The client should not repeat the request without modifications.
  • Bad Request: Error 400.
  • Bad Request – Invalid URL.
  • Bad Request. Your browser sent a request that this server could not understand.
  • HTTP Error 400 – Bad Request.
  • HTTP Error 400. The request hostname is invalid.
  • Snapd returned status code 400: Bad request.
  • The webpage cannot be found.

Nguyên nhân xảy ra lỗi 400 Bad Request

Một trong những nguyên nhân phổ biến nhất là do sai cú pháp URL hoặc trong URL có chứa các ký hiệu đặc biệt hoặc các ký tự không hợp lệ.

Tuy nhiên, ngay cả khi URL chính xác tuyệt đối thì lỗi 400 Bad Request vẫn có thể xảy ra do các tệp bị hỏng trong bộ nhớ tạm của trình duyệt hoặc các vấn đề với cookie của trình duyệt đã hết hạn hoặc bị hỏng. Bạn có thể gặp lỗi này vì cách cookie xử lý dữ liệu xác thực đăng nhập của bạn có thể bị hỏng và có thể không xác thực thành công bạn là người dùng hợp lệ có quyền quản trị viên.

Ngoài ra, lỗi 400 Bad Request còn có thể xảy ra khi server website gặp trục trặc hoặc các sự cố tạm thời không xác định khác.

Nguyên nhân của lỗi
Nguyên nhân của lỗi

Cách sửa lỗi 400 Bad Request

Kiểm tra URL

Đầu tiên, bạn nên kiểm tra xem URL đã nhập chính xác chưa? Có sai chính tả hay bị dư ký tự nào không? Hãy chắc chắn rằng bạn đã viết chính xác URL và nếu URL chứa các ký tự đặc biệt, hãy đảm bảo rằng chúng đã được mã hóa chính xác và là các ký tự URL hợp pháp. Kiểm tra thật kỹ nếu gặp phải lỗi.

Kiểm tra URL
Kiểm tra URL

Xóa Cookie trình duyệt

Khi dữ liệu đọc cookie bị hỏng hoặc quá cũ, một số trang web sẽ báo lỗi 400 nên bạn có thể xóa Cookie của website để khắc phục.

Xóa Cookie trình duyệt
Xóa Cookie trình duyệt

Xóa bộ nhớ đệm DNS

Nếu nguyên nhân do bản ghi DNS lưu trữ trên máy tính bị hỏng hoặc đã lỗi thời thì thao tác xóa cookie DNS sẽ khắc phục được lỗi 400 Bad Request. Để sử dụng cách này, bạn hãy nhấn tổ hợp phím Windows + R để mở cửa sổ Run, gõ “cmd” và nhấn Enter.

Sau khi hiện cửa sổ Windows command prompt, gõ lệnh ipconfig /flushdns và nhấn Enter. Sau khi hiện ra dòng lệnh Successfully flushed the DNS Resolver Cache thì bạn đã xóa thành công.

Xóa bộ nhớ đệm DNS
Xóa bộ nhớ đệm DNS

Xóa bộ nhớ đệm của trình duyệt

Một trong những giải pháp khác để bạn khắc phục lỗi 400 Bad Request chính là việc xóa bộ nhớ cache của trình duyệt. Mặc dù thao tác này có thể không khắc phục được hoàn toàn lỗi 400 nhưng đây cũng là một lựa chọn mà bạn không nên bỏ qua vì nó khá đơn giản để thực hiện.

Xóa bộ nhớ đệm của trình duyệt
Xóa bộ nhớ đệm của trình duyệt

Kiểm tra kích thước file tải lên

Khi bạn muốn upload một file gì đó lên mà báo lỗi 400 Bad Request, khả năng là do file bạn quá nặng khiến máy chủ của website không thể overload, quá tải và không thể nhận được hết thông tin. Hãy nhấn F5 để tải lại trang, kiểm tra lại file, giảm kích thước của nó bằng các công cụ để nén các tệp lớn bạn nhé!

Kiểm tra kích thước File
Kiểm tra kích thước File

Kiểm tra tình trạng kết nối Internet

Bạn có thể chạy kiểm tra tốc độ mạng bằng cách khởi động lại wifi máy tính hoặc thiết bị phát internet internet. Đây cũng là một trong những cách hữu hiệu để sửa lỗi 400 Bad Request vô cùng hiệu quả.

Kiểm tra tình trạng kết nối Internet
Kiểm tra tình trạng kết nối Internet

Liên hệ với bên website

Nếu bạn đã thử hết những cách trên nhưng vẫn gặp phải lỗi này, thì chắc là vấn đề của website mà bạn truy cập. Hãy liên hệ với quản trị viên của Website để được hỗ trợ nhé! Điều này cũng đóng góp một phần trong việc quản lý website có thể khắc phục vấn đề đấy!

Liên hệ với bên website
Liên hệ với bên website

Với những thông tin về lỗi 400 Bad Request ở trên, hy vọng bài viết sẽ mang lại nhiều thông tin hữu ích cho bạn. Hãy chia sẻ kinh nghiệm của bạn về lỗi này dưới phần bình luận, đừng quên chia sẻ bài viết nhé. Cảm ơn bạn đã theo dõi bài viết!

Leave a Reply

Your email address will not be published. Required fields are marked *